Transaction 66592f71fdc0aa9152b06c91a194eb34248ec392be22fcff37aaafeba63d1969

1 Input
2 Outputs
  • 66592f71fdc0aa9152b06c91a194eb34248ec392be22fcff37aaafeba63d1969:0
  • value  114891
    address  151R2Yea5CT8JdpbNL8zv2EqDJFeiLtNid
  • 66592f71fdc0aa9152b06c91a194eb34248ec392be22fcff37aaafeba63d1969:1
  • value  733700
    address  1LELVkxHRRC9GMG9vZ2asRbRAhEYxqdLHv